White rice is rice with the bran and germ removed, leaving polished, pearlescent grains. It cooks to tender, fluffy kernels with a mild, slightly nutty taste; its starch makes it adaptable to pilaf, fried rice, congee, and sushi styles. Sold as long-, medium-, and short-grain, including jasmine, basmati, parboiled, and instant forms.

Domesticated in Asia, white rice became widespread as milling removed outer layers for storage and texture; it now anchors cuisines across East, South, and Southeast Asia and much of the world. Modern mills hull, polish, and sort grains by length and quality.
